Symbols - The use of international graphic symbols is highly desirable to offset ... duty of care psychological injuriesWebElevator code dictates that under Phase I operation, elevators that are 25 feet or more above the main floor return either to a designated landing area or an alternate area. Phase I operation is activated either manually by a special key, or automatically by a fire alarm initiating device. A sensor could detect smoke in the hoistway or machine ... duty of care referral
